Across TCGA patient cohorts, OSBPL6 mutation is significantly associated with the RNA expression of many other genes, with 5,246 significant associations in total. UCEC shows the largest number of these associations.

The most reproducible OSBPL6-associated genes across cancer lineages are SOD1, NDUFA6, and DCK. Each is linked with OSBPL6 in more than 4 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both OSBPL6-to-partner and partner-to-OSBPL6 results are reported.
